MASQ™ Patent Application Targets AI Agent Governance Challenges
On July 16, 2026, Integrated Quantum Technologies announced the filing of a provisional patent application with the United States Patent and Trademark Office for MASQ™ (Machine Action Security Quotient). The patent, titled "Infrastructure-Layer Mediation System and Method for Governing Autonomous AI Agent Actions," includes over 55 claims and significantly expands the company’s AI infrastructure intellectual property portfolio.
The filing reflects management’s recognition that as enterprises deploy autonomous AI agents capable of system access, tool invocation, code execution, and financial transactions, a dedicated infrastructure layer is necessary to independently govern, monitor, and secure these machine actions beyond existing application-level controls or AI model behavior governance.
MASQ™ Technology Architecture and Governance Features
MASQ™ is being developed as an infrastructure-layer governance platform that evaluates, authorizes, and audits autonomous AI agent actions prior to execution. Unlike solutions relying solely on application-level controls or AI model behavior, MASQ™ provides policy enforcement, identity verification, secure interactions with external tools and enterprise systems, execution governance, and tamper-evident audit capabilities across enterprise AI environments.
The provisional patent covers technologies including infrastructure-layer policy enforcement, secure tool interactions, agent identity and delegation, representation isolation, transaction governance, and action-level security scoring. Innovations in Policy Enforcement and Security Scoring
The MASQ™ provisional patent application’s 55+ claims include technical advancements in autonomous AI agent governance at the infrastructure layer. Key features include action-level security scoring, which assesses risk profiles of proposed agent actions before execution, and representation isolation, which separates agent state and decision-making from the AI model’s architecture.
Transaction governance claims emphasize control over financial and operational transactions initiated by autonomous agents. MASQ™’s infrastructure-layer oversight ensures agents cannot circumvent governance controls, even if the underlying AI model behaves unpredictably, differentiating it from solutions relying solely on model-level controls or post-execution monitoring.

This MASQ™ filing is Integrated Quantum’s second major patent submission following its provisional patent for VEIL™. The dual filings demonstrate a strategy to build a comprehensive IP portfolio addressing key enterprise AI infrastructure layers—data protection via VEIL™ and agent action governance via MASQ™. This complementary IP could gain significant value as enterprises adopt privacy-preserving and securely governed AI infrastructure.
Provisional patents in the U.S. grant priority dates and allow time to refine claims before filing full utility patents.
